The "( ̄ロ ̄;)" emote, also known as the "Sweating Beg" emote, is typically used to convey a sense of anxiety, nervousness, or embarrassment. The wide eyes and droplets of sweat on the forehead suggest that the person is feeling uncomfortable or uneasy about something. It is often used in online conversations, particularly in response to a request or favor that makes the person feel awkward or hesitant.
- "I have a big presentation tomorrow and I haven't finished preparing yet... ( ̄ロ ̄;)"
